US Cash Crude-Grades mixed as domestic crude stocks fall, fuels rise

ReutersJul 16, 2025 8:45 PM

- Grades were mixed on Wednesday, dealers said, and investors digested official U.S. oil stock data, which showed a drop in crude inventories and rise in fuel stocks last week.

Crude stockpiles fell by 3.9 million barrels to 422.2 million barrels in the week ended July 11, the Energy Information Administration said, compared with analysts' expectations in a Reuters poll for a 552,000-barrel draw.

Meanwhile, gasoline stocks rose by 3.4 million barrels in the week to 232.9 million barrels, the EIA said, compared with expectations for a one million-barrel draw.

Elsewhere, drone attacks for a third day on oilfields in Iraq's semi-autonomous Kurdistan region have slashed crude output by 140,000 to 150,000 barrels per day, two energy officials said on Wednesday, as infrastructure damage forced multiple shutdowns.

The region's total production was around 285,000 bpd, Iraqi Kurdistan energy officials said.

* Light Louisiana Sweet WTC-LLS for August delivery rose 15 cents to a midpoint of a $2.80 premium and was seen bid and offered between a $2.60 and $3.00 a barrel premium to U.S. crude futures CLc1

* Mars Sour WTC-MRS fell 5 cents to a midpoint of a 30-cent discount and was seen bid and offered between a 40-cent and 20-cent a barrel discount to U.S. crude futures CLc1

* WTI Midland WTC-WTM was steady at a midpoint of a 45-cent premium and was seen bid and offered between a 35-cent and 55-cent a barrel premium to U.S. crude futures CLc1

* West Texas Sour WTC-WTS rose 3 cents to a midpoint of a 10-cent discount and was seen bid and offered between a discount of 20 cents and parity to U.S. crude futures CLc1

* WTI at East Houston WTC-MEH, also known as MEH, traded between a 55-cent and 75-cent a barrel premium to U.S. crude futures CLc1

* ICE Brent September futures LCOc1 fell 19 cents to settle at $68.52 a barrel

* WTI August crude CLc1 futures fell 14 cents to settle at $66.38 a barrel

* The Brent/WTI spread WTCLc1-LCOc1 narrowed 3 cents to last trade at minus $3.31, after hitting a high of minus $3.25 and a low of minus $3.34
